在数字经济迅速发展的今天,虚拟货币已成为一个广泛关注的话题。尤其是在过去几年中,虚拟货币市场的波动性吸引了众多投资者的目光,同时也让普通用户对虚拟币的查询需求日益增加。为了满足大众用户的这种需求,本文将深入探讨一个虚拟币查询系统的构建,包括它的功能、技术实现及应用场景。
### 一、虚拟币查询系统的基本功能
首先,一个理想的虚拟币查询系统应具备多种基本功能,以满足用户在不同场景下的需求。
#### 1. 实时价格查询
实时价格查询是虚拟币查询系统最基本的功能之一。用户可以实时查看各类虚拟币的市场价格,包括比特币、以太坊、Ripple等主流虚拟币的最新行情。通过API接口,系统能够从各大交易所获取最新价格,并进行更新,使用户能够判断最佳的交易时机。
#### 2. 历史数据分析
除了实时价格,历史数据的分析也至关重要。用户可以查询不同虚拟币在特定时间范围内的价格变动情况,系统可以提供图表展示,帮助用户更好地分析市场趋势。对于投资者而言,历史数据可以作为制定交易策略的重要依据。
#### 3. 交易量与市值查询
交易量和市值是反映虚拟币市场活跃程度的重要指标。查询系统需要提供这些信息,帮助用户了解某一虚拟币的受欢迎程度和市场流动性。系统可以显示过往交易量与当前市值的对比,进行市场分析。
#### 4. 多种货币支持
随着全球化的发展,用户可能会涉及不同国家和地区的虚拟币。因此,系统应支持多种主流货币,用户可以选择自己熟悉的货币进行查询,提升用户体验。
### 二、虚拟币查询系统的技术实现
虚拟币查询系统的实现需要结合多种技术。下面将讨论可能使用的技术架构与工具。
#### 1. 数据采集
数据采集是虚拟币查询系统的核心功能之一,通常通过API接口从各大交易所抓取数据。例如,使用CoinGecko、CoinMarketCap等API,可以获取实时的价格数据和交易量信息。这些数据可以使用Python等编程语言编写脚本进行定时抓取。通过设置定时任务,系统能够实现数据的自动更新。
#### 2. 数据存储
在数据存储方面,可以使用关系型数据库(如MySQL)或非关系型数据库(如MongoDB)来存储虚拟币的数据。关系型数据库适合存储结构化的数据;而非关系型数据库则适合处理较为复杂的数据,例如用户的历史查询记录和分析数据。这些数据可以帮助系统进行更精准的用户推荐。
#### 3. 数据展示
数据展示是用户与系统的交互界面。可以使用现代前端框架(如React、Vue.js)构建用户界面,使其更加美观和易用。结合数据可视化库(如D3.js、Chart.js),可以将历史数据以图表的形式展示,方便用户进行分析。
#### 4. 系统安全与性能
安全性与性能是系统的两个重要指标。为了保证用户数据的安全,系统需要采取加密措施,防止数据被恶意攻击。同时,通过负载均衡与缓存机制(如使用Redis)来系统性能,提升用户访问体验。
### 三、虚拟币查询系统的应用场景
以下是一些虚拟币查询系统的典型应用场景:
#### 1. 投资决策支持
对于投资者而言,虚拟币查询系统可为其提供实时的价格信息和市场分析,帮助其做出更为理智的投资决策。用户可以通过系统评估当前市场的走向及潜在盈利机会。
#### 2. 教育与学习
虚拟币查询系统也适合用于教育场景,尤其是想要学习数字货币知识的用户。通过系统提供的历史数据和市场分析,用户可以了解虚拟货币的基本原理、市场动态以及分析方法。
#### 3. 风险管理
市场波动巨大,用户通过查询系统获取的实时信息,可以更好地管理投资风险。系统可以提供价格报警功能,一旦价格达到用户设定的阈值,可以及时通知用户,帮助其做出快速反应。
### 四、相关问题讨论 在构建虚拟币查询系统的过程中,可能会有一些相关问题,下面将逐个进行详细介绍。 ####在数字货币日益普及的今天,虚拟币查询系统的安全性显得尤为重要。首先,数据的传输过程应采取加密措施,如HTTPS协议,保证用户信息的安全性;其次,数据库的安全性也不可忽视,可以采用定期备份和权限管理措施,确保数据不被非法访问。同时,系统可以引入防火墙和入侵检测系统,监控不正常的访问活动。此外,为了保障用户资金的安全,系统应避免存储过多的敏感信息,尤其是涉及私人钱包的私钥信息。通过以上措施,能够从多角度确保虚拟币查询系统的安全性。
####
提高虚拟币查询系统的响应速度涉及多个方面。首先,可以通过数据库查询、使用索引等手段提升数据处理速度。其次,系统可以建立缓存机制,将频繁查询的数据先行缓存,进一步缩短用户访问的响应时间。此外,可以通过负载均衡将用户请求分散到多台服务器上处理,达到提升整体性能的目的。同时对前端页面进行,压缩资源,减少HTTP请求次数,也有助于提升用户体验。整体而言,综合多种技术手段可以有效提高查询系统的响应速度。
####用户体验是影响虚拟币查询系统成功与否的重要因素。用户体验可以从多个方面进行:首先,设计应,使用户可以方便快捷地找到所需信息。其次,界面响应应快速,减少用户等待时间。此外,增加个性化功能,如用户自定义关注币种、价格报警等,能够提高用户的黏性。同时,在系统中提供清晰的数据解读和教育内容,帮助用户快速理解市场动态,也是提升体验的重要方法。用户体验的不仅能提高满意度,还有助于用户的持续使用和推广系统。
####
确保虚拟币数据的准确性对于虚拟币查询系统至关重要。首先,需选择可靠的第三方数据API供应商,尽量避免使用不明来历的API。其次,可以通过多家数据源进行数据比对,若存在显著差异,则需要进一步核实。此外,也可对比历史数据与当前价格波动,确认其合理性。同时,定期进行系统内部的数据审核,发现数据异常要及时处理,确保用户获得准确、可信的行情信息。通过以上措施,可以在很大程度上提升虚拟币查询系统中数据的准确性。
####随着虚拟货币市场的快速发展,虚拟币查询系统逐渐增多,市场竞争也愈发激烈。首先,从功能上来看,各系统提供的服务逐渐趋于同质化,如何在功能上进行差异化创新是关键;其次,要注重用户体验,提升系统的易用性和美观度,从而吸引用户的持续关注。市场竞争还可从营销策略入手,选择合适的广告渠道,吸引目标用户群体。通过综合运用差异化的功能、出色的用户体验及有效的市场营销,能够在竞争中占据有利位置。
####虚拟币查询系统的用户可以分为多个群体。投资者是最主要的用户,他们需要实时监测市场价格、市场走势和不同币种的交互情况;其次是学习者,他们对数字资产的概念、使用方法感兴趣,通过虚拟币查询系统获取知识和了解市场;还有一些炒币者,他们通常注重短期交易,对币种的波动状况非常敏感。此外,交易所、金融机构等专业用户也倾向于使用这类查询系统,进行更深层的数据分析与挖掘。了解这些用户的特征可帮助系统更精准地制定功能与营销策略。
综上所述,虚拟币查询系统是满足现代用户多元化需求的重要工具。它不仅能够提供实时数据,还能辅助用户进行市场分析与决策。通过持续的技术迭代与用户体验,未来的虚拟币查询系统必将在数字货币市场中发挥更大的价值。希望本文的探讨能够为有意构建或使用虚拟币查询系统的用户提供一定的参考与帮助。
2003-2025 tp官方正版 @版权所有 |网站地图|桂ICP备2021006830号